2. Commercial Bank Checking Accounts
A checking account is one of the most basic services offered by commercial banks.
They allow customers to deposit and withdraw money easily and typically come with features like online banking and bill pay. Many checking accounts also offer overdraft protection, which can be helpful for individuals who occasionally spend more money than they have in their accounts.
3. Savings Accounts
The other popular service that commercial banks offer is savings accounts, where customers deposit money and receive interest on the deposits plus the money deposited in the bank with little to no fees associated. A savings account is best used for short-term goals or emergencies.
4. Money Market Accounts
Money market accounts are just like savings accounts but usually carry a higher interest rate. They also have higher minimum balances and allow fewer withdrawals per month. Therefore, by way of example, a money market account might suit someone who wants to earn a little more interest on their savings while maintaining some easy access to their cash.
5. Commercial Bank Certificates of Deposit
Certificates of Deposit (CDs) are a type of savings account that requires customers to keep the money with the bank for a fixed period, usually anywhere from six months to five years. CDs will pay a higher interest rate than savings accounts, but the money cannot be withdrawn by the customers without a penalty. CDs are suitable for someone who puts money aside and who will not have to touch them for some period.
6. Loans
Commercial banks make many types of loans to individuals and businesses, such as personal loans, auto loans, and busines loans. Customers can borrow money and also repay the amount with interest over a period. Interest and terms of a loan may vary. It depends on the type of loan and the credit history of the borrower.
7. Credit Cards
Credit cards are a type of loan. They allow customers to make purchases and pay them off over time. They typically come with interest rates and fees and can be a good option for individuals who want to build credit or earn rewards.
8. Debit Cards of Commercial Bank
Debit cards are linked to a checking account and allow customers to make purchases and withdraw money from ATMs. Unlike credit cards, debit cards do not come with interest rates or fees. They can be a good option for individuals who want to avoid going into debt.
9. ATM Services
ATM operations are tailored for customers in commercial banks. Therefore, ATM facilities provided by commercial banks allow customers to withdraw cash and check account balances. Some banks have deposit-taking ATMs, which allow customers to deposit checks and cash without visiting a bank branch.
